LEVY PRESTON "PIE" MYERS

May 3, 1945-Oct. 24, 20-17

Levy Preston "Pie" Myers, 72, Clayton, died Tuesday evening in Laurels of Forest Glenn in Garner.

Born May 3, 1945, in Johnston County to the late Stephen Henry and Annie Ruth Creech Myers, he was preceded in death by two brothers, James Myers and Glenn Myers, and his faithful dog "P.J."

He attended Clayton Church of God of Prophecy.

Funeral services will be conducted at 11 a.m. Friday, Oct. 27, 2017, in the chapel of Parrish Funeral Home in Selma, with the Rev. Ronnie Massey officiating. Burial will follow in Price Cemetery near Selma.

The family will receive friends from 6 to 8 p.m. Thursday at the funeral home and at other times, at the home of his sister, Bonnie, 104 Butler Road, Dudley, N.C.

Surviving are his companion of 44 years, JoAnn Fowler; sisters, Bonnie Myers Davis and husband, Jimmy, of Dudley and Shirley D. Myers and companion, Richard Collins, of Goldsboro; three grandchildren; one great-grandchild; and a special friend, Pete Parrish.

Flowers are acceptable or memorials may be made to the Johnston County Animal Shelter, 115 Shelter Way, Smithfield, N.C., 27577.
